Eddie has been making steady progress throughout the last year and will continue to compete in national and international competitions throughout 2011. He is the current British U17 and U18 champion and is now the youngest lifter in the U23 categorary. He is aiming to become the top ranked lifter in Great Britain as he strives for selection onto the GB Senior squad.

He began weightlifting at school and now trains five days a week for two to three hours at a time. His main goals are to win the British Junior title, qualify for the European Junior Championships and gain more Great Britain selections.
